This activity was originally created for the #TrainLikeanAstronaut Challenges as a part of ESA Education’s Expedition: Home initiative.
Using items around the house, like pillows, create a pathway from one side of the room to the other. Try to move across the room on this objects, avoiding obstacles and never touching the floor.
- Household items to be used as stepping-stones
